I just looked at the HP-23 schematic.

Is that a voltage tripler, from 268 to 820 no load?

What if it were changed to a doubler?


>> You can build a 650-700 volt HV supply with 120/240 volt isolation
>> transformer.
>>
>> 240 * 1.414 = 340
>> 340 * 2 = 680
>>
>> You can buy these transformers from Allied, Mouser, and DigiKey.
>>
>> They are a viable solution to the problem.
